About The Company
We are the LEGO Group, the company behind the world’s most loved LEGO® bricks. Our brand name derived from the two Danish words Leg Godt, which mean “Play Well”. We’ve been sparking imaginations and inspiring the builders of tomorrow since 1932. This is our mission and what motivates our colleagues around the world every day. Today, we remain proudly family-owned with headquarters in Billund, Denmark. We have regional hubs in Boston, USA; London, UK; Shanghai, China; and Singapore, as well as 7 manufacturing facilities around the world. These places are home to 31,000+ colleagues in everything from design and engineering to digital technology and marketing. Together we learn, imagine and build – creating play experiences that are sold in over 130 countries worldwide. Core Responsibilities

  • Collaborate closely with BU sales and marketing teams to create accurate forecasts and meaningful insights for new product launches, promotions and account level plans (flows)

  • Build dashboards, analyse historical data and drive benchmark analysis to suggest the correct forecast levels for key SKU’s

  • Develop SKU level forecast based on insights received from other teams and statistical models provided by the systems

  • Connect short-term and long-term plans between BU team and Regional DP team to ensure correct inventory levels across the value chain

  • Monitor the BU performance and initiate corrective actions if necessary based on the findings

  • Be an active participant of S&OP process and facilitate key meetings together with BU DP teams

The Operations team in the Singapore Malaysia Travel Retail (SMTR) Business Unit (BU) ensures seamless flow of information from our direct and distributor markets to the supply chain and ensures the flow of goods back to the markets. You will work in collaboration to on demand planning activities with sales and marketing teams, as well as deepening the partnership with regional Supply Chain Operations team and customers.

Having the right forecast allows the LEGO Group to minimize excess inventory in our own DC’s and customers, ensure product availability in the right place in the right quantity and at the right time.
